Preventing Jet Lag
Try and avoid travelling when you are already tired amd rest before departure. On the flight get maximum sleep aided by a mild hypnotic if necessary.
Stretch and exercise as much as possible to aid circulation and prevent swollen ankles.
Drink plenty of water or soft drinks to counteract the dry cabin atmosphere.
Avoid excessive alcohol and caffeine which increase dehydration.
Jet lag is made worse by a hangover!
Breaking very long journeys halfway with a stopover can be helpful.
Avoid heavy commitments on the first day after arrival.
Some people find the use of melatonin to be helpful, however its effect as yet,is scientifically unproven.
